一、原始数据类型布尔值布尔值是最基础的数据类型,在 TypeScript 中,使用 boolean 定义布尔值类型let isTrue: boolean = false;数值使用 number 定义数值类型let num: number = 1;字符串使用 string 定义字符串类型let name: string = "Tom";Null 和 Undefined可以使用 null 和 unde
转载
2023-12-12 13:36:26
104阅读
System.Collections.ArrayList类是一个特殊的数组。通过添加和删除元素,就可以动态改变数组的长度。 一.优点1、支持自动改变大小的功能2、可以灵活的插入元素3、可以灵活的删除元素 二.局限性跟一般的数组比起来,速度上差些 三.添加元素1.public virtual int Add(objectvalue);将对象添加到ArrayList的结尾
转载
2024-08-10 20:21:29
65阅读
在实际的 TypeScript 开发中,我们常常需要根据特定场景传递参数并指定默认值。这种需求不仅提升了代码的灵活性,也能提高用户的体验。在本文中,我们将详细介绍“TypeScript 传递参数 指定值”的相关问题,包括具体的问题场景、调试过程、相关性能优化和最佳实践。
## 背景定位
在一个大型TypeScript项目中,函数通常需要接受多个参数来执行不同的逻辑。为了简化函数的调用,开发者可
枚举部分 Enumeration part 使用枚举我们可以定义一些有名字的数字常量。 枚举通过 enum关键字来定义。 Using enumerations, we can define some numeric constants with names. Enumeration is defined by the enum keyword.enum Direction {
Up = 1
类数组对象和对象文章开始先来看一下js中数组对象和类数组对象。在js中数组是一个对象,数组对象继承自Array对象var arr1 = [];
var arr2 = new Array();这两种方式定义出来的数组,由于Array.prototype上有大量的方法,因此数组对象可以使用多种方法。那么既然数组是一个对象,那么我们自然会想到用一个普通的对象来模拟数组对象,于是就出现了类数组对象v
转载
2024-07-17 21:42:52
107阅读
TypeScript 基础学习(一)数据类型总结:联合类型和交叉类型类型别名类型断言: as函数 先把前两天学习的基础的数据类型记录一下 数据类型// 先可以在空文件夹中tsc init 然后生成tsconfig.json里面的outDir改为./js
// 然后在vscode中 点击上方终端 运行任务 监视TS就可以在修改此ts文件时自动生成对应的js文件
// 布尔类型 :后面的叫
转载
2024-04-16 16:58:43
271阅读
一. 相关属性indexvaluesshapesizedtypenamehead tailSeries对象可以通过index与values访问索引与值。其中,我们也可以通过修改index属性来修改Series的索引。说明:如果没有指定索引,则会自动生成从0开始的整数值索引,也可以使用index显式指定索引。Series对象与index具有name属性。Series的name属性可在创建时通过nam
转载
2024-02-27 07:42:01
233阅读
一、概念 在TypeScript中,我们可以使用接口来定义对象的类型。在面向对象的语言中,接口是一个很重要的概念,是对行为的一种抽象。但在TS中,接口是一个灵活的概念,除了可以表达对行为的抽象,也可以表示对象的形状(属性和方法)。// 定义一个接口
interface Person {
name: string;
age: number;
}
// 定义对象的类型为上面的
转载
2023-08-28 17:42:55
297阅读
# TypeScript Interface 类型指定值范围的实现
## 引言
在 TypeScript 中,我们可以使用接口(Interface)来定义对象的结构和类型。接口可以用于声明函数的参数、定义类的属性和方法等。除了定义属性和方法的类型,我们还可以使用接口来限制属性的取值范围。本文将介绍如何使用 TypeScript 接口来指定值的范围。
## 流程概述
下面是实现这一功能的整体流程
原创
2023-08-25 07:24:02
415阅读
作用:全局计数 在简单Spark Streaming上开启checkpoint机制,很简单,只要调用jssc的checkpoint()方法,设置一个hdfs目录即可jssc.checkpoint("hdfs://master:9000/wordcount_checkpoint");updateStateByKeypublic Optional<Integer> call(List<
转载
2024-09-23 14:46:44
51阅读
## 如何实现“Java Map 修改指定值”
作为一名经验丰富的开发者,你需要教会一位刚入行的小白如何实现“Java Map 修改指定值”。下面我将为你详细介绍这个过程。
### 流程图
```mermaid
flowchart TD
A(开始)
B[创建Map对象]
C[修改指定值]
D(结束)
A --> B
B --> C
原创
2024-05-22 05:32:37
22阅读
前言上篇文章讲到 flask 的模板文件如何使用,印象模糊的朋友可以回顾一下flask入门 (二)(不用写代码的前端!)今天的主题 - flask 和静态文件结合的使用技巧。静态文件概念先来简单的介绍下,静态文件是什么?静态文件(static files),在通常的 web 项目下,指的是内容不需要动态生成的文件。比如图片、CSS 文件和 JavaScript 脚本等。就像下面通过 F12 审查元
# 如何在Java中修改字符串指定索引位置的值
作为一名经验丰富的开发者,我将会教你如何在Java中实现修改字符串指定索引位置的值。这是一个基本的字符串操作,但对于刚入行的小白来说可能需要一些指导。
## 流程图
```mermaid
erDiagram
确定要修改的索引位置 --> 提取字符串中的字符 --> 修改字符值 --> 重新构建新的字符串
```
## 详细步骤
在实
原创
2024-04-22 03:31:13
124阅读
3.4 DML → update 修改数据update 表名 set 字段名 = 新值 条件找到要修改的值修改所有条数据的该字段值update `表名` set `字段名` =‘值’;修改单条数据的该字段值(用其它字段值来判断)update `表名` set `字段名` = ‘值’ where `其它字段名`=当前的值条件:where 子句 运算符(返回 boolean 值)操作符意义范围结果=等
转载
2024-02-02 16:09:16
71阅读
TypeScript Symbol本节介绍 symbol 类型的语法、使用方法和应用场景,每个从 Symbol() 返回值的唯一性是使用 symbol 类型的最重要原因。1. 慕课解释symbol 是一种基本数据类型(primitive data type)。Symbol() 函数会返回 symbol 类型的值。每个从 Symb
js基础之数组API以下表格中添加*的方法不会改变原数组。属性描述*concat()连接两个或更多的数组,并返回结果*join()把数组的所有元素放入一个字符串。元素通过指定的分隔符进行分隔pop()删除并返回数组的最后一个元素push()向数组的末尾添加一个或更多元素,并返回新的长度shift()删除并返回数组的第一个元素unshift()向数组的开头添加一个或更多元素,并返回新的长度rever
# 使用 TypeScript 获取 JSON 的指定值
## 介绍
在开发过程中,我们经常需要处理 JSON 数据。TypeScript 是一种强类型的 JavaScript 超集,它提供了一些方便的方法来获取 JSON 数据的指定值。在本文中,我将指导你如何使用 TypeScript 来实现获取 JSON 的指定值。
## 流程
下表列出了获取 JSON 的指定值的流程:
| 步骤
原创
2023-12-09 08:27:37
367阅读
# Java枚举类型指定索引值的实现
## 引言
在Java中,枚举类型(enum)是一种特殊的数据类型,它可以定义一组常量。每个枚举常量都具有唯一的名称和值。在某些情况下,我们可能希望为枚举常量指定特定的索引值。本文将介绍如何在Java中实现指定枚举索引值的方法。
## 整体流程
首先,让我们来看一下实现Java枚举类型指定索引值的整体流程,如下所示:
```mermaid
flowc
原创
2024-01-21 08:38:56
115阅读
什么是TypeScript,为什么我们要要尝试它呢? Typescript是JavaScript的超集,可编译为纯JavaScript。 顾名思义,typescript为我们提供了一种编写类型安全的JavaScript的方法,就像使用其他强类型语言(如C#或Java)一样。JavaScript是一种有效的Typescript,其类型是可选的,因此可以轻松地将JavaScript项目迁移到Type
转载
2024-06-18 18:00:45
15阅读
# Python 修改字符串指定索引位置的值方法
在Python编程中,我们经常需要对字符串进行各种操作,而其中一个常见的需求就是修改字符串中特定索引位置的值。字符串在Python中是不可变的,也就是说,一旦创建之后就不能直接修改。要实现这个功能,我们通常会通过以下步骤:
1. 将字符串转换为列表
2. 修改列表中的指定元素
3. 再将列表转换回字符串
## 修改字符串的步骤
以下是具体实